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from the Badajoz bus station (Estación de Autobuses), exit the station and head southeast on Avenida de Elvas. Continue straight for about 800 meters until you reach the intersection with Calle de la Libertad. Turn right onto Calle de la Libertad and continue walking for approximately 600 meters. As you approach the Plaza de España, keep an eye out for the signs directing you to the Plaza de los Reyes Católicos. The plaza is just a short walk from here; continue straight for another 300 meters, and you will find the Plaza de los Reyes Católicos on your right.

  • Walking

    If you are at the Badajoz city center (Plaza de España), from the plaza, head south on Calle de Francisco Pizarro. Walk for about 200 meters until you reach the intersection with Calle de la Cruz. Turn left onto Calle de la Cruz and proceed for another 300 meters. The Plaza de los Reyes Católicos will be on your left, just off the main street.

  • Public Transport

    If you are near the Parque de la Concordia, you can take bus number 3 from the nearby bus stop (Parada de Autobús 'Concordia') heading towards the city center. After a 5-minute ride, get off at the stop 'Plaza de España.' From there, follow the walking directions provided above to reach the Plaza de los Reyes Católicos, which is only a short distance away.

Discover more about Plaza de los Reyes Católicos

Plaza de los Reyes Católicos is the vibrant heart of Badajoz, Spain, where history and modernity converge. This bustling town square is surrounded by stunning architecture that reflects the rich heritage of the region, making it an ideal spot for tourists to soak in the local culture. As you stroll through the plaza, you will be captivated by the charming atmosphere, with the sound of laughter and conversation echoing from the numerous cafes and restaurants that line the square. The plaza serves as a communal hub, where locals gather to socialize, celebrate, and enjoy various events throughout the year. In addition to its lively ambiance, Plaza de los Reyes Católicos is a great place to relax and people-watch. The spacious layout makes it a perfect spot to unwind after a day of exploring Badajoz's historic sites, such as the nearby Alcazaba or the Cathedral of Badajoz. The square often hosts cultural activities, including concerts and art exhibitions, providing visitors with a taste of the local arts scene. Don't miss the opportunity to try regional delicacies at the nearby eateries, where you can savor authentic Spanish cuisine while enjoying the view of the bustling square.
